Task 2 configure a compute instance to generate custom cloud monitoring metrics
Task 2 configure a compute instance to generate custom cloud monitoring metrics. CPU utilization Jun 3, 2024 · The compute instance metrics help you measure activity level and throughput of compute instances. In the left menu select Dashboards, and then +Create Dashboard. To create your own metrics, see Create user-defined metrics with the API, User-defined agent metrics, and Logs-based metrics. Task 2. For more information, see List and chart log-based metrics and Alert on log-based metrics. The monitoring resource names for Cloud Run are: Cloud Run Revision (cloud_run_revision) Cloud Run Job (cloud Oct 20, 2013 · Recommended metrics. google. The metrics listed in the following table are available for any monitoring-enabled compute instance. As mentioned, there are two types of Custom Metrics in AWS. 5 days ago · Charts and alerting policies in Cloud Monitoring. You can use both system and user-defined log-based metrics in Cloud Monitoring to create charts and alerting policies. You can configure Prometheus with Cloud Monitoring. Jun 11, 2021 · Source: Reddit. Oct 18, 2021 · In addition, they propagate Prometheus metrics to Google Cloud Monitoring to take advantage of its rich capabilities. You will create a virtual machine in Project 2, and then monitor both projects in Cloud Monitoring. See Supported Services and Viewing Default Metric Charts. For example, Compute Engine reports over 25 unique metrics for each virtual machine (VM) instance. Logs-based metrics: Task 2. These metrics are called standard or platform. Jun 3, 2024 · Compute instance metrics are supported on current platform images and on custom images that are based on current platform images. js, PHP, Python and Ruby. Name the dashboard Cloud Monitoring LAMP Qwik Start Dashboard. 4 days ago · Cloud Monitoring pricing summary. Create a custom metric using Cloud Operations logging events. Task 3. Configure a Compute Instance to generate Custom Cloud Monitoring metrics. This lab describes how to deploy an autoscaling Compute Engine instance group that is automatically scaled using a custom Cloud monitoring metric Create a VM instance with a custom hostname. For an introduction to the concepts and terminology used in the Cloud Monitoring metric model, see Metrics, time series, and resources. Resource types. For information about how to configure our Google Cloud project to view metrics for multiple Google Cloud projects and AWS accounts, see Metrics scopes overview. For more information about Cloud Monitoring pricing, see the following documents: Cloud Monitoring pricing summary. Task 4. Mapping Cloud Monitoring metric names to PromQL 4 days ago · The following sections describe the query tools available in Cloud Monitoring with Metrics Explorer: PromQL; Monitoring Query Language (MQL) Monitoring filters; You can create Cloud Monitoring dashboards and alerting policies for your metrics. At the top of the screen, click on the dropdown arrow next to Project 1's name. Create a VM by clicking Create instance. 6 days ago · Method Used for; TrackPageView: Pages, screens, panes, or forms. In the Google Cloud console, go to the VM instances page: Go to VM instances. For more information about resources, metrics, and filters, see the reference for Cloud Monitoring API: Sep 15, 2023 · Amazon Elastic Compute Cloud (Amazon EC2) emits several metrics for your EC2 instance to Amazon CloudWatch. We also walk you through on how to store custom configuration in AWS Systems Manager Parameter Store used by CloudWatch 11 key cloud metrics to monitor. Acknowledgments. There This dimension is available only for Amazon EC2 metrics when the instances are in such an Auto Scaling group. In this image, the Min Interval field is set to 1 minute : For comparison, the following screenshot illustrates the effect of changing the interval from 1 minute to 5 minutes : 6 days ago · In this article. If you use an older platform image, you must manually install the Oracle Cloud Agent software before you can use the Compute Instance Monitoring plugin. One such metric is CpuUtilization. Create a Task 2: Configure a Compute Instance to generate Custom Cloud Monitoring metrics In the Cloud Console , click the Navigation menu > Compute Engine > VM Instances . To get these metrics, enable monitoring on the instance. Sep 30, 2021 · In Google Cloud Platform (GCP), for example, you can create custom metrics with the OpenCensus service, which is a set of libraries for multiple programming languages that enable you to collect app metrics. Go back to the Logs Explorer page (Navigation menu > Logging > Logs Explorer). OCI Monitoring Endpoint. 4 days ago · If you use VPC Service Controls, then you need to consider the order in which you configure a metrics scope and your VPC perimeters. Apr 17, 2023 · Introduction With more and more customers embark journey to the Oracle Cloud, we see customers raise questions about Observability and Management best practices for Cloud Resources. Add the first chart. Alternatively, you can use log-based metrics to collect custom metrics. 4 days ago · The Linux agents collect all of the metrics listed in the following table from processes running on Compute Engine VMs and, by using the Monitoring agent, Amazon Elastic Compute Cloud (EC2) VMs. Before you begin. ImageId: This dimension filters the data you request for all instances running this Amazon EC2 Amazon Machine Image (AMI). Combining the collection of logs, metrics, and traces into a single process, the Ops Agent uses Fluent Bit for logs, which supports high-throughput logging, and the OpenTelemetry Collector for metrics and traces. You can disable their collection by the Ops Agent (versions 2. To configure a condition for a custom metric type before that metric type generates data, you must specify the metric type by using a Monitoring filter: Select ? on the Select metric section header and then select Direct filter mode in the tooltip. The metrics in this namespace are aggregated across all the related resources on the instance. Create VM instances that use the gVNIC network interface. Create Project 2's virtual machine. Azure makes some metrics available to you out of the box. Sep 10, 2024 · Cloud Monitoring ingests that data and generates insights with dashboards, charts, and alerts. Oct 23, 2015 · Now that, I want to monitor it using google cloud monitoring ( https://app. These applications This is a self-paced lab that takes place in the Google Cloud console. For example, custom_metrics. . Custom metrics published using the Monitoring API. Let’s take a look at how you can use these custom May 9, 2024 · The initial dashboard configuration incldues some charts that display stats about the latency of the video upload Cloud Function. By default, many services provide free metrics for resources (such as Amazon EC2 instances, Amazon EBS volumes, and Amazon RDS DB instances). 4 days ago · The Ops Agent is the primary agent for collecting telemetry from your Compute Engine instances. To collect metrics data from your Compute Engine instances, create an Agent Policy that automatically installs and maintains the Google Cloud Observability agents across your fleet of VMs. In this blog, I’m going to create a custom metric first and then use it to create our dashboard, without leaving our editor! Our focus will be on two methods specifically 6 days ago · Retention of metrics Platform and custom metrics. These metrics provide information about how the service is operating. Apr 2, 2024 · You can display the metrics collected by Cloud Monitoring in your own charts and dashboards. Custom metrics are performance indicators or business-specific metrics that can be collected via your application's telemetry, the Azure Monitor Agent, a diagnostics extension that runs on your Azure resources, or an external monitoring system. Create a Jul 25, 2024 · Compute Engine instances - A variable number of Compute Engine instances. What For example, the Compute service posts metrics for monitoring-enabled compute instances through the oci_computeagent namespace. Cloud Monitoring pricing. Click Update Chart to view custom metric in Metrics Explorer. A custom metric used for autoscaling must have the following Configure a Compute Engine application for Cloud Operations Monitoring custom metrics. By default, Amazon EC2 delivers a set of metrics related to your instance to CloudWatch in the AWS/EC2 namespace. For example, the Amazon RDS console might display a metric in megabytes (MB), while the metric is sent to Amazon CloudWatch in bytes. We also show you how to publish those custom metrics and monitor them on Amazon CloudWatch console. In this section you create the charts for the lab metrics and a custom dashboard. Compute Engine instances - A variable number of Compute Engine instances. Metrics are data about the performance of your systems. Configure Cloud Monitoring. Task 2: Configure a Compute Instance to generate Custom Cloud Monitoring metrics #Task 2: Configure a Compute Instance to generate Custom Cloud Monitoring metrics May 9, 2024 · You first enabled Cloud Monitoring for your project and then configured a Compute Instance to generate custom metrics. 0 and higher) and by the legacy Monitoring agent. 5 days ago · Cloud Monitoring supports the metric types from Google Cloud services listed in this document. In Cloud Monitoring, log-based metrics use the following naming patterns: Mar 14, 2020 · Custom Metrics primarily there to extract RAM details, Instance Swap details or any other custom metric. Add custom metrics to a Cloud Monitoring Dashboard. 6 days ago · Containers including Prometheus metrics; Databases; Security events in combination with Azure Sentinel; Networking events and health in combination with Network Watcher; Custom sources that use the APIs to get data into Azure Monitor; You can also export monitoring data from Azure Monitor into other systems so you can: Task 4. You then created a custom metric using Cloud Operations logging events and added custom metrics to the Media Dashboard in Cloud Operations Monitoring. Sep 5, 2024 · To use custom metrics, you must first create a custom metric that is associated with one of the monitored-resource types. Sep 10, 2024 · This document describes how to configure Google Kubernetes Engine (GKE) to send metrics to Cloud Monitoring. Several memory heavy applications like Big Data Analytics, In-memory Databases, Real-time Streaming require you to monitor memory utilization on the instances for operational visibility. However, memory metrics isn’t one of the default metrics provided by Amazon EC2. Creating an instance template; Task 4. Task 5. Short description. Watching the instance group perform autoscaling; Task 9. For a complete list of available system metrics, see Google Cloud All Cloud Monitoring code samples; Back up policies; Bulk enable policies that match a filter; Create a custom metric; Create a notification channel; Create an alerting policy, in the context of recreating policies from a backup. Is there any way that I can push a custom metric to cloud monitoring from a script in compute engine to achieve this? Jul 26, 2021 · In my previous blog in this series, I wrote about how you can create custom monitoring metrics using the Python client library for Google Cloud monitoring APIs, and thereby automate this process. js script is running; Task 7. Optional: Install the Ops Agent to gather more detailed data from your Compute Engine instances. Monitoring cloud metrics is essential to ensure the optimal performance, availability, and cost-efficiency of your cloud infrastructure. Select metric name, interval and dimension name and dimension value. Enable the APIs. TrackEvent: User actions and other events. Aug 24, 2023 · Overview Here, we will create a Compute Engine managed instance group that autoscale based on the value of a custom Cloud Monitoring metric. The CPU and memory reservation and the CPU, memory, and EBS filesystem utilization across your cluster as a whole, and the CPU, memory, and EBS filesystem utilization on the services in your clusters can be measured using these metrics. Configure autoscaling for the instance groups; Task 8. Click on the three dots next to video-queue-monitor instance, then click Stop . In Cloud Shell, run the following to generate some errors: Sep 10, 2024 · For more information about creating a monitoring alerting policy, using the Metrics Explorer, or for general information on how monitoring and metrics work on Google Cloud, see Cloud Monitoring documents. Google Cloud Monitoring lets you monitor a set of resources together as a single group. Objectives. You can also use the GCP Cloud Monitoring API to create custom metrics, which works with C#, Go, Java, Node. Add custom metrics to the Media Dashboard in Cloud Operations Monitoring. Publishing Custom Metrics. Sep 10, 2024 · You can create and manage custom dashboards and the widgets through the Cloud Monitoring API and gcloud monitoring dashboards command. Create a VM instance. This includes CPU utilization and a set of NetworkIn and NetworkOut metrics. Create VMs in bulk. Next you'll generate some errors to match the log-based metric you created and trigger the metric-based alert. Autoscaling 5 days ago · You can use Prometheus Query Language (PromQL) to query all metrics in Cloud Monitoring, including Google Cloud system metrics, Kubernetes metrics, custom metrics, and log-based metrics. Overview. Creating the application; Task 2. 4 days ago · Enable the Compute Engine, Cloud Monitoring, and Cloud Logging APIs. Task 1. Create a VM instance with a high performance computing (HPC) image. Highly scalable and . For a general explanation of the entries in the tables, including information about values like DELTA and GAUGE, see Metric types. Generate some errors. For information about the Cloud Monitoring data model, see Metrics, time series, and resources. GKE provides several sources of metrics: 4 days ago · System metrics generated by Google Cloud services are automatically collected and stored by Cloud Monitoring. Setup and requirements; Task 1. Author - Dipesh Kumar Rathod (Master Principal Cloud Architect Sep 10, 2024 · Enable the Compute Engine and Cloud Monitoring APIs. Verifying that the instance group has been created; Task 6. Create a logging metric. In case of any failure of script, I would like to get a SMS/E-mail. Related Links. Configure autoscaling for the instance group; Task 8. stackdriver. com). Create an uptime check; Delete a custom metric; Delete a notification channel; Delete an uptime check; Get a metric Sep 10, 2024 · Save a chart's configuration. Create a VM instance with attached GPUs. 0. Getting started. In this task, you create a metric that you can use to generate alerts if too many web requests generate access denied log entries. The following example is a completed configuration file of Google Cloud's Agent for SAP running on a Compute Engine VM instance, where the collection of SAP HANA monitoring metrics is enabled. Creating the instance group; Task 5. Platform and custom metrics are stored for 93 days with the following exceptions: Classic guest OS metrics: These performance counters are collected by the Windows diagnostic extension or the Linux diagnostic extension and routed to an Azure Storage account. Challenge scenario. For more information, see Manage dashboards by API . Click on + ADD WIDGET Dec 26, 2018 · In this blog post, we show you how to configure the CloudWatch agent on Amazon EC2 Windows instances to capture custom metrics for SQL Server from Windows performance monitor. Your next task is to confirm that the monitoring service that checks the length of the video processing queue is working correctly. Amazon ECS provides free CloudWatch metrics you can use to monitor your resources. Custom Cloud Monitoring metric - A custom monitoring metric used as the input value for Compute Engine instance group autoscaling. Billable metrics are billed by either the number of bytes or the number of samples ingested. 4 days ago · To explore Cloud Monitoring, try the Quickstart for monitoring a Compute Engine instance. In that case metrics exported by Prometheus are converted to Cloud Monitoring metric types. Create and start an Arm VM instance. Note that the custom query included in this example, named custom_query , follows the custom query definition guidelines specified in Defining custom 6 days ago · Create custom metrics. 4 days ago · In general, Cloud Monitoring system metrics are free, and metrics from external systems, agents, or applications are not. Used to track user behavior or to monitor performance. Verifying that the Node. Cloud Monitoring allows you to create custom metrics based on the arrival of specific log entries. Create a bucket; Task 3. When you manage custom dashboards by using the Cloud Monitoring API, you can use Metrics Explorer to help you construct the data you provide to the API: To generate the JSON representation for a chart that you plan to add to a dashboard, configure the chart with Metrics Explorer. Custom Metrics via CloudWatch Agents (Recommended way) Custom Metrics via CloudWatch Monitoring Scripts; EC2 Monitoring via CloudWatch Monitoring The Amazon RDS console might display metrics in units that are different from the units sent to Amazon CloudWatch. Each metrics scope can support up to five-hundred groups and up to six layers of sub-groups. CloudWatch metrics that are available for your instances; Install and configure the CloudWatch agent using the Amazon EC2 console to add additional metrics; Statistics for CloudWatch metrics for your instances; View the monitoring graphs for your instances; Create a CloudWatch alarm for an instance; Create alarms that stop, terminate, reboot CloudWatch metrics that are available for your instances; Install and configure the CloudWatch agent using the Amazon EC2 console to add additional metrics; Statistics for CloudWatch metrics for your instances; View the monitoring graphs for your instances; Create a CloudWatch alarm for an instance; Create alarms that stop, terminate, reboot Aug 30, 2024 · When disabled, the menu lists all metrics for Google Cloud services, and all metrics with data. EC2 Monitoring via Custom Metrics. Cloud Monitoring performs the VPC perimeter check when a resource container is added to a metrics scope: When you create the VPC perimeter first and then try to add a resource container to the metrics scope, the Jan 31, 2024 · Create the metrics-based alert . If you use the search bar to find this page, then select the result whose subheading is Compute Engine. Sep 12, 2019 · Custom monitoring metrics are metrics that you write and use like any other metric in Stackdriver, including for alerting and dashboards. For information about dashboards and the types of charts you can use, see Dashboards and charts. Available for instances with Detailed or Basic Monitoring enabled. Create and configure Monitoring groups. Create a VM instance with an attached instance schedule. OCI offers a range of tools and services for monitoring the health and performance of your cloud resources, including your databases, compute instances, network, application stack, etc. By keeping a close eye on these cloud metrics, you can proactively identify and address potential issues: 1. Create a VM instance if you don't already have one: In the Google Cloud console, go to the VM instances page: Go to VM instances. In this lab, you will learn how to perform the following tasks: Deploy an autoscaling Compute Engine instance group. Groups can then be linked to alerting policies, dashboards, etc. To generate custom metrics from your Cloud Run service, you can deploy a sidecar agent such as OpenTelemetry or Prometheus. Metrics in Cloud Monitoring can populate custom dashboards, generate alerts, create service-level objectives, or be fetched by third-party monitoring services using the Cloud Monitoring API. Under Resources, click Metrics. 4. Retention for these metrics is 4 days ago · The following screenshot illustrates the CPU utilization of the Compute Engine VM instances in a particular Google Cloud project. Mar 19, 2024 · Project 1 already has a virtual machine (and you can look at it by going to Compute Engine > VM instances). ezecgvfitbouapvgekkfxftthpugpdqvvcoezdlxqqdid